CONDOMINIUMS:
Condo coverage limits, apply to the value of the units interior, or "Studs-In" structure.
HOMES & TOWNHOUSES:
This limit applies to the entire dwelling ( Interior & Exterior )
Only the cost to "Rebuild the structure" applies. (The land and market value does not )
OTHER STRUCTURES:
Separate garages, barns, guest cottages and entrance area fencing are covered by a separate limit.
Pools, gazebo's, sport courts: See policy details for sub limits that may apply.

LOSS ASSESSMENT PAYMENTS
Subject to the Loss Assessment “limit of insurance” shown in the Declarations, “we” will pay “your” share of any loss assessment charged against “you” by a corporation or association of property owners because of a “covered event” during the policy period.
This coverage only applies when the assessment is made, as a result of direct physical loss to “covered property” owned by all members collectively, caused by a “covered event”. This coverage applies only to loss assessments charged against “you” as owner of the “residence premises”. “We” do not cover loss assessments charged against “you” or a corporation or association of property owners by any government body.
The Loss Assessment “limit of insurance” shown in the Declarations is the most “we” will pay with respect to any one ”covered event”, regardless of the number of assessments.
Most other quake insurance carriers, require a huge deductible, equivalent to 10% - 20% of the "Homes Structures - Coverage Limit".
Example: A homes structure value is $300,000 x 10% = $30,000 Deductible
This means, the value of the direct quake damage, must exceed $30,000, before a claim can be filed, to pay for damages above this amount.
